Lucy Letby trial update
What is the update on Lucy Letby‘s trial? Lucy Letby has been accused of killing seven babies; five boys and two girls. Sources also indicate that she has been attempting to kill ten more babies. However, she has denied all 22 charges made against her at Manchester Crown Court.
According to Nick Johnson KC, there were a number of abnormal baby deaths in the neonatal unit at the Countess of Chester hospital. After several investigations and study, they noticed that the deaths occurred every time there was the presence of Lucy Letby at the hospital.
“Having searched for a cause, which they were unable to find, the consultants noticed that the inexplicable collapses and death did have a common denominator. The presence of one of the neonatal nurses and that nurse was Lucy Letby,” Johnson said.
It was revealed that in the period between 2015 and the middle of 2016, Lucy Letby poisoned two babies with insulin.
